1. Unveiling the Symphony: Preparing Your Headphones for Connection

Before embarking on the journey of connecting your Sony noise-canceling headphones, it is essential to ensure they are adequately prepared for the task. Begin by verifying that the headphones are fully charged, ensuring an uninterrupted connection experience. Locate the power button, typically situated on the right ear cup, and press and hold it until the LED indicator illuminates, signaling that the headphones are powered on.

With your headphones powered on, the next step is to initiate the pairing process, forging a wireless connection between your headphones and your chosen audio source. Activate the Bluetooth function on your device, be it a smartphone, tablet, or laptop. Navigate to the Bluetooth settings menu and select the option to search for new devices. Once the headphones appear on the list of available devices, select them to initiate the pairing process.

3. Verifying the Union: Confirming a Successful Connection

Once the pairing process is complete, a confirmation message will typically appear on your device’s screen, indicating that the connection has been established. To ensure a seamless audio experience, verify that the headphones are selected as the active audio output device on your device. This can be done through the sound settings menu, where you can designate the headphones as the preferred audio output.

5. Optimizing the Connection: Ensuring a Seamless Audio Experience

To ensure a consistently seamless connection, consider the following tips:

  • Maintain a close proximity between your headphones and the connected device. Excessive distance can lead to signal interference and audio dropouts.
  • Keep the headphones and the connected device free from obstructions, such as walls or metal objects, which can disrupt the Bluetooth signal.
  • Update the firmware of your headphones regularly to ensure compatibility with the latest devices and features.

6. Troubleshooting Common Connection Issues: Resolving Audio Hiccups

In the event of connection issues, such as intermittent audio dropouts or pairing difficulties, try the following troubleshooting steps:

  • Ensure that both the headphones and the connected device have sufficient battery power.
  • Verify that the headphones are within the recommended range of the connected device.
  • Disable and then re-enable the Bluetooth function on both the headphones and the connected device.
  • Restart both the headphones and the connected device.

7. Transcending Boundaries: Exploring the Realm of Wired Connection

While wireless connectivity offers unparalleled freedom, there are scenarios where a wired connection may be preferred. To establish a wired connection, locate the audio input port on your headphones, typically a 3.5mm jack. Connect a compatible audio cable to the port and the other end to the audio output of your device. Once connected, the headphones will automatically switch to wired mode, allowing you to enjoy your audio content without the need for a Bluetooth connection.
